How Much Larger Will The Push-To-Talk Telemedicine And mHealth Convergence Market Become By 2030 Compared To 2026?
The push-to-talk telemedicine and mhealth convergence market size has seen rapid expansion in recent years. This market is forecasted to increase from $5.24 billion in 2025 to $6.04 billion in 2026,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 15.3%. Historically, this growth can be attributed to factors such as increasing mobile device penetration in healthcare, the expansion of telemedicine services into rural areas, a rising demand for rapid clinical communication, growing needs for chronic disease monitoring, and the adoption of secure healthcare communication tools.
The push-to-talk telemedicine and mhealth convergence market is expected to experience significant expansion over the coming years. It is projected to achieve a size of $10.57 billion by 2030,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 15.0%. This growth during the forecast period is fueled by increased investments in connected healthcare ecosystems, a rising need for real-time patient engagement, the expansion of wearable-enabled care models, a heightened focus on emergency telehealth services, and the integration of AI-driven communication analytics. Notable trends during this period involve the increasing integration of push-to-talk capabilities with wearable health devices, a growing deployment of real-time mobile communication platforms in healthcare settings, wider adoption of cloud-based telemedicine infrastructure, the broadening of emergency response communication solutions, and an enhanced emphasis on remote care coordination.

Which Strategic Drivers Are Supporting The Push-To-Talk Telemedicine And mHealth Convergence Market Development?
The increasing need for remote healthcare services is projected to stimulate the expansion of the push-to-talk (PTT) telemedicine and mHealth convergence market in the coming years. Remote healthcare involves providing medical assistance and care remotely through digital technologies, eliminating the need for physical visits. The growing appeal of remote healthcare stems from patients’ desire for greater convenience and ease of access, allowing them to receive medical attention without travel, thereby saving time and minimizing exposure to contagions. Push-to-talk telemedicine and mHealth convergence solutions facilitate remote healthcare by enabling instantaneous voice communication between patients and medical practitioners. These technologies boost care coordination through immediate connections, enhancing response times and availability for both urgent and routine health situations. For example, data from August 2025 by the Office of Inspector General, U.S.-based Department of Health & Human Services (OIG), indicated that in 2024, Medicare payments for remote patient monitoring surpassed US $536 million, representing a 31 % increase from 2023. Additionally, close to 1 million enrollees utilized RPM services, a 27 % rise from 2023, and roughly 4,600 medical practices regularly billed for RPM. Consequently, the rising demand for remote healthcare services is a key factor propelling the growth of the push-to-talk (PTT) telemedicine and mHealth convergence market.

What Is The Largest Regional Market In The Push-To-Talk Telemedicine And mHealth Convergence Market?
North America was the largest region in the push-to-talk telemedicine and mhealth convergence market in 2025. Asia-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ing region in the forecast period.
